Amsterdam – April 3, 2012….. VidiGo’s support for Adobe® AIR® enables broadcasters and content creators to use standard technology to build tickers, crawls and animations.

Three years ago we introduced our VidiGo Graphics product line as a viable means to create graphics for broadcast with Adobe Flash®. Today we introduce the next generation of VidiGo Graphics, taking the full potential of the latest 3D capabilities of Flash and include full support for the Adobe AIR platform. Adobe AIR® paves the way to graphics development needs for today and the future. In addition to Flash (Action script and SWF), web technologies like HTML5 allow for even greater choice of development environments to take the most creative and real-time connected graphics to air in no time. Use any device (PC, Mac, IOS or Android) to take control of your graphics workflow. Other than on the web, in broadcast there is a need for a high frame consistency and smooth playback. This is why we have redesigned our engine to render at the highest quality.

The Adobe Flash based overlays enable you to easily add logos, animations, ads, promos, news banners, twitter feeds etc. to the output SDI signal. No need for expensive specialists to create graphics. Adobe Flash support simplifies and reduces the cost of the traditional time-consuming broadcast graphics creation process.

VidiGo Graphics serves as a bridge between Adobe Creative Suite® and TV productions.
